No mystery we love the Burnout series here at Cultured Vultures, yet clearly EA and Criterion are comparably susceptible to making another one as Valve are to making another Portal game. Whenever another hustling game goes along that has even the smallest whiff of that exemplary series, we are in general on top of it, so Three Fields Entertainment’s Dangerous Driving ought to have been a sure thing.

Tragically, the game didn’t feel like it satisfied its true capacity, generally because of spending plan limitations more than whatever else. The center motor was unshakable, however all the other things around it, similar to the feeble UI, absence of authorized soundtrack and tasteless track configuration, hauled the center insight down. Fortunately, Three Fields Entertainment are back to attempt once more with Wreckreation, and the thought alone makes it sound like a programmed champ.

At a base level, Wreckreation means to be like Burnout Paradise and more present day Need For Speed games, which checks out given Three Fields Entertainment’s involvement in both of those establishments. Players will actually want to investigate a gigantic open world, contending in occasions and causing fast butchery as you smash your opponents off the street. Nonetheless, Wreckreation doesn’t get its name since it’s a quip on “diversion”. This is on the grounds that creation is a particularly key piece of the game’s equation.

The sandbox is being alluded to as MixWorld, and permits players to drop track pieces, stunt inclines and different bits of math to make their own occasions, tracks and tomfoolery. Think Trackmania and you’re along the right lines. Having the option to investigate an open world in a dashing game, and afterward screw with it by adding items and pieces, is essentially unbelievable on this scale. Indeed, GTA Online permits players to make monstrous trick race tracks, however that is only for one unambiguous mode.

All the more as of late, Forza Horizon 4 and 5 have been messing with creation content in their open world hustling games, however what gives Wreckreation the edge on other dashing games is the way to deal with online play. Rather than making and transferring tracks disconnected and afterward transferring them so anyone might be able to see, you can really take off and put objects close by your companions, while they’re actually hustling.

This component makes Wreckreation such an unbelievably astonishing possibility, particularly for players who love the inventive part of dashing games. Having the option to put race tracks in the open world while your companions are hustling implies you’ll have the option to acquire moment criticism with regards to testing how the track functions. Assuming Wreckreation satisfies its true capacity, it very well may be the most cooperative structure insight beyond Minecraft.

Presently, there’s no delivery date yet for Wreckreation. It’s additionally just recorded for PC, however the brief ongoing interaction we were shown included Xbox regulator data so it wouldn’t be amazing if the game advanced toward PlayStation and Xbox as well. With two previously settled equations mixed together as Burnout and Trackmania, Wreckreation could be the following extraordinary dashing game to watch.
